Clyde C. Thompson III, age 65, passed away peacefully surrounded by love on March 3, 2026. He was the devoted husband of Laura I. Thompson, with whom he shared 31 wonderful years of marriage and a lifetime of friendship.
Clyde was born on April 5, 1960, to Clyde C. Thompson Jr. and Florence Mooneyhan Thompson. Throughout his life, Clyde was known for his steady character, loyalty, and quiet kindness to those around him.
He built a successful career as a systems engineer with Motorola, where he worked for many years before retiring in 2015. In addition to his professional career, Clyde dedicated his time to serving others. He proudly served in the Air National Guard and spent several years as a volunteer firefighter, always willing to step forward to help his community.
In recent years, Clyde and Laura embraced the life they loved most, spending the better part of the last 15 years enjoying the beauty and peace of the Outer Banks. The beach became their happy place, where they made countless memories together. Their home was also a haven for animals, especially the dogs they lovingly called their “fur babies.” Clyde and Laura shared a special love for animals and took great joy in giving many dogs a loving home.
In addition to his beloved wife Laura, Clyde is survived by his three sisters: Joyce Greer of Columbia, Pam (Marty) Motley of Hopkins, and Pat (Danny) Whittle of West Columbia, along with a number of nieces, nephews, great-nieces, and great-nephews who will remember him with love.
A private graveside ceremony for immediate family will be held on March 12, 2026, at 11:00 a.m.
In lieu of flowers, the family asks that memorial donations be made in memory of Clyde to the Outer Banks SPCA or Pet’s Inc. in West Columbia, South Carolina, honoring his deep love for animals.
Clyde will be remembered for his loyalty, gentle spirit, and the love he shared with those closest to him.
